#37284d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#37284d is composed of 21.6% red, 15.7%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.6% cyan, 48.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 69.8% black. It has a hue angle of 264.3 degrees, a saturation of 31.6% and a lightness of 22.9%. #37284d color hex could be obtained by blending #6e509a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#37284d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09060c is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#37284d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3a3a3b is the less saturated color, while #300471 is the most saturated one.
